Output 7d868741561eee20a3cb23346e7a6df8aed851b08052b99b0e226ae960271fcc:0

value
2590768
script pubkey
OP_0 OP_PUSHBYTES_20 e32e0aecf0da582e89ab84768b8f36b7856a0388
address
bc1quvhq4m8smfvzazdts3mghrekk7zk5qug8z7mx8
transaction
7d868741561eee20a3cb23346e7a6df8aed851b08052b99b0e226ae960271fcc
spent
true